And so, what essentially is a stair lift? A stair lift is an useful piece of equipment that can help you to be mobile and also it brings you down and up the staircases, allowing you to move around in your place with ease as well as engage in things that you would most likely be not capable to undertake normally.

A stair lift is in a nutshell a mechanized seat that assists to elevate you up and down the staircases. A track or rail is commonly mounted to the stairway treads as well as a seat or a hauling platform is affixed to the track. In Grant County, you can easily get onto the chair or the platform as well as the chair glides along the path allowing you get up and also down the stairs. You additionally have styles wherein you can easily take your wheelchair on the stair lift as well as these are known as platform lifts.

Stair Lifts are a significant assistance to the elderly people and also individuals with movability difficulties that believe it a demanding task to move down and up the stairs in their house.

Safety and Comfort

A stair lift provides automated passage up and down the stairs. The seat of the stair lift offers a lap belt that makes certain that you are safe when the stair lift is in motion. Today, the majority of stair lifts have built-in protection attributes that are going to avoid its operation in case it comes across an obstruction on the stairs or if any type of portion of the stair lift such as the seat, armrests or even footrest is actually not in its right setting. The stair lifts in addition are outfitted with a safety lock that protects against any type of accidental use or kids from using the chair.

Normally, the chair of the stair lift features a changeable and also cushioned seating and armrests that ensure best comfort. You can likewise adjust the footrest depending on to your height.

Staircase Accessibility

Many stair lifts feature quite slim profiles and also do not clog the whole stairs, which is openly reachable. Generally, the chair, along with the foot rest are collapsible to ensure that it is not an obstacle for family and also other individuals intending to use the staircases.

Easy To Use

Stair Lifts are very user-friendly as well as handle. Most stair lifts have a button located on the armrest of the chair that enables you to handle it. Now a days, many stair lift versions are actually supplied with a remote control that allows you to control it quite easily and gets the stair lift to the top or the bottom of the stairs as needed. When the stair lift is in the park stance, it charges, to make sure that you can make use of it whenever you want to and also just in case there is a electricity disruption, the stair lift commonly has an in-built battery back up that enables you to run it.

Different Types Of Stair Lifts

There are various kinds of stair lifts like:

Stair Lifts for Straight Stairs​

If your dwelling includes a straight staircase, then a stair lift that operates along a straight path or rail is certainly the most typical kind of stair lift. These also feature drop-down or fixed chairs that are attached. The installation of a stair lift of a straight stairs can end up being an issue if the staircases are far too thin. If your staircase is mostly straight but it contains a curve at the top, then you can pick a straight stair lift and also a joining platform that serves to help the lift to come to the landing a lot better. Generally, straight stair lifts are the least expensive and simplest to install.

Stair Lifts for Curved Stairs​

If your staircases are curved, then you ought to set up a curved stair lift. These are actually far more complicated compared to straight stair lifts as well as they need rounded rails to accommodate the exact contour of the staircase. Normally, curved stair lifts are much more costly.

Wheelchair and Platform Stair Lifts​

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or "IPL" Is a lift that is connected to your stairs. It transports mobility devices back and forth the stairs rather than a separate equipment like an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ms may fold up against the wall, while others remain fixed. Selections depend on your requirements and your home. Most inclined platform lifts come with the selection for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their preference. Inclined platform lifts require ample headroom, stairway width, and also landing space at the base of the stairs. Incline wheelchair lifts are a good alternative for those that do not wish to transfer on and off their wheelchair for them to go up and down the stairs. It is a great solution to enhance accessibility around stairs. This is an optimal alternative for individuals that do not have the area for or the resources for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their home. Enables an individual in a mobility device to get up as well as decline stairs without having to transfer from mobility device or mobility scooter Uses a system that rides backwards and forwards the staircases For both inside and also exterior Folds up out of the way while not in use Has safety stop sensors & battery backup Both are reputable as well as secure for wheelchairs as well as users.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ts​

These forms of stair lifts are commonly installed outside on stairways that lead to your main door or on stairs going to your yard or even patio. Exterior stair lifts are essentially similar to straight or curved stair lifts that are used inside; but, these are normally made with weather-proof materials.

Standing Stair Lifts​

If your staircase is particularly rather slender and it will not accommodate a chair stair lift, then a standing stair lift is preferred. On the other hand, you have to make sure that you have ample clearance in the stairs ,as well,that it is elevated enough to fit you when you are standing. Standing stair lifts are particularly effective for individuals having problems moving their legs. Some standing stair lift designs also offer a little ledge that helps you to keep your balance. Even so, standing stair lift may not be appropriate for everybody, particularly if you do not have the sturdiness to stand up for a number of minutes or even if you are prone to getting light-headed.

Do I need a Stair Lift in Dayville?

1. What is a stair lift?

A stair lift is a motorized chair that moves along a rail mounted to the treads of the stairs. It helps individuals with mobility issues to travel up and down stairs safely and comfortably.

2. Who can benefit from a stair lift?

Stair lifts are beneficial for individuals with limited mobility, such as seniors, people with disabilities, or those recovering from surgery or an injury.

3. How much does a stair lift cost?

The cost of a stair lift can vary widely depending on the model, features, and whether it is for a straight or curved staircase. Generally, prices range from $2,000 to $15,000.

4. Can a stair lift be installed on any type of staircase?

Stair lifts can be installed on most types of staircases, including straight, curved, and even outdoor stairs. Custom configurations are available for more complex staircases.

5. How long does it take to install a stair lift?

Installation time can vary, but a standard straight stair lift can typically be installed in a few hours. Curved stair lifts, which require custom rails, may take longer.

6. Are stair lifts safe to use?

Yes, stair lifts are designed with safety features such as seat belts, swivel seats, footrest sensors, and emergency stop buttons to ensure safe operation.

7. What happens if there is a power outage?

Most stair lifts are equipped with battery backups that allow them to operate during a power outage. The battery will need to be recharged once power is restored.

8. How do I maintain a stair lift?

Regular maintenance is important to keep a stair lift in good working condition. This includes cleaning the rail, checking for loose bolts, and scheduling annual professional inspections.

9. Can stair lifts be rented or leased?

Yes, many companies offer rental or lease options for stair lifts, which can be a cost-effective solution for short-term needs.
